2007 Ford Ka vs. 1993 Volkswagen Passat

To start off, 2007 Ford Ka is newer by 14 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1993 Volkswagen Passat.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1993 Volkswagen Passat would be higher. At 1,895 cc (4 cylinders), 1993 Volkswagen Passat is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Ford Ka (94 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 20 more horse power than 1993 Volkswagen Passat. (74 HP @ 4200 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2007 Ford Ka should accelerate faster than 1993 Volkswagen Passat.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1993 Volkswagen Passat weights approximately 124 kg more than 2007 Ford Ka.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1993 Volkswagen Passat (150 Nm @ 2200 RPM) has 14 more torque (in Nm) than 2007 Ford Ka. (136 Nm @ 4250 RPM). This means 1993 Volkswagen Passat will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2007 Ford Ka.
